SCHX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2023 in Review

1,071 of the 6,369 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Schwab US Large- Cap ETF (SCHX) for Q2 2023, worth a combined $21.8B — up 3.9% from $21B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 80 funds opened new SCHX positions and 40 closed out — a net gain of 40 holders — while 376 added to existing stakes and 448 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Diversified, adding an estimated $61.9M. The largest seller was Mercer Global Advisors, cutting an estimated $480M.
